How Roofing System Ventilation Functions
Reliable roof ventilation depends on the natural motion of air to create a balance between consumption and exhaust. When you set up vents, you're essentially permitting fresh air to enter your attic room while making it possible for warm, stagnant air to run away. This process aids regulate temperature and moisture degrees, stopping issues like mold and mildew growth and roofing damage.
Consumption vents, typically located at the eaves, reel in trendy air from outdoors. Key Setup Factors To Consider
When setting up roof air flow, a number of crucial considerations can make or break your system's effectiveness. First, you need to assess your roof covering's style. The pitch, shape, and materials all influence air movement and ventilation choice. Make certain to select vents that suit your roofing system type and regional environment problems.
